Health-Conscious Offerings
Plant-Based Menus on the Rise
With a growing awareness of health and sustainability, many fast food chains are expanding their plant-based options. Consumers are increasingly seeking alternatives to meat, not only for ethical reasons but also for health benefits. Major brands are introducing plant-based burgers, chicken nuggets, and even breakfast items made from alternatives like tofu, tempeh, and legumes. The trend is expected to continue, as restaurants aim to cater to a diverse clientele while promoting a healthier lifestyle.
Nutritional Transparency
In response to heightened awareness about nutrition, fast food chains are adopting transparent practices. Diners increasingly demand detailed information regarding calorie counts, ingredient sourcing, and nutritional value. Many establishments are now incorporating QR codes on menus, allowing customers to access comprehensive nutritional data instantly. This transparency not only builds trust but also empowers consumers to make informed choices.
Sustainability Initiatives
Eco-Friendly Packaging
The fast food industry is under pressure to reduce its environmental footprint, prompting a shift toward eco-friendly packaging. Many chains are phasing out plastic straws, utensils, and containers in favor of biodegradable or recyclable materials. This trend is likely to gain momentum as consumers become more environmentally conscious and expect brands to prioritize sustainability in their operations.
Sourcing Locally
A growing emphasis on local sourcing is another significant trend. Fast food restaurants are increasingly partnering with local farms and suppliers to provide fresh ingredients. This not only supports local economies but also enhances the quality and taste of the food. Customers appreciate knowing where their food comes from, and local sourcing aligns with the trend toward supporting sustainable agriculture practices.
Technological Innovations
Contactless Ordering and Payment
The pandemic accelerated the adoption of contactless technology in the fast food sector. This year, many restaurants are enhancing their mobile apps and digital platforms to facilitate seamless ordering and payment processes. Features such as mobile ordering, curbside pickup, and delivery services are becoming standard, making it easier for customers to enjoy their favorite meals with minimal interaction.
AI and Automation
Artificial intelligence and automation are increasingly playing a role in the fast food industry. From chatbots that assist with customer service to automated kitchens that streamline food preparation, technology is optimizing operations. These innovations can enhance efficiency, reduce wait times, and improve overall customer satisfaction, making them key trends to monitor.
Menu Innovation and Customization
Fusion Cuisine
The blending of different culinary traditions is giving rise to innovative menu items that appeal to adventurous eaters. Fast food chains are experimenting with fusion cuisine, incorporating flavors and ingredients from various cultures. Whether it’s a taco stuffed with Korean BBQ or sushi burritos, these creative combinations are attracting consumers looking for unique dining experiences.
Personalization and Customization
Consumers are increasingly seeking meals tailored to their tastes and dietary restrictions. Fast food establishments are responding by allowing diners to customize their orders, whether it’s choosing specific toppings, adjusting spice levels, or selecting gluten-free or vegan options. This level of personalization enhances customer satisfaction and encourages repeat visits.
Global Flavors
International Influences
As the world becomes more interconnected, global flavors are making their way into fast food menus. Dishes inspired by international cuisines, such as Mediterranean wraps, Indian curries, and Asian street food, are gaining traction. Fast food establishments are keen to tap into these diverse flavors, offering customers a taste of the world without leaving their hometown.
Seasonal and Limited-Time Offerings
Brands are increasingly incorporating seasonal and limited-time offerings to create excitement and urgency. These promotions often highlight exotic ingredients or unique flavor profiles, encouraging customers to try something different. By rotating menu items, fast food chains not only keep their offerings fresh but also create opportunities for marketing and social media engagement.
